Canto Falls ‘Tapestry’

Canto Falls are an explosive alternative indie-rock three piece based in London. Their new single ‘Tapestry’ will be released this Friday 26th. Having formed in 2016, founding members Mark Howarth and Adam Gillian quickly discovered a mutual appreciation of dense lyrics and careful musical arrangement combined with high-energy pop sensibilities and with the addition of James Thackeray’s shared eye for detail, the band’s unique and exciting sound began to take shape. Over the course of a year, the band have carefully crafted songs with exciting, high-energy compositions that demand your attention and blur the line between ‘pop’ and ‘indie-rock’. With their first single ‘Clarity’ released on the 2nd of October 2017 and the follow-up release ‘Tapestry’ set for release tomorrow, the three-piece have their sights set on making a fresh and explosive sonic impact.

‘Tapestry’ is a richly embellished über-catchy indie pop track brimming with sweet melody and vibrant colour. A lavish rumbling rhythm adds a nice whack of rough and tumble through the luscious pop speckled track. Jangly guitars glitter and sparkle throughout with delicate twinkles on keys flickering between smooth vocals and a dreamy positive melody. Its honey glazed and spongy, wrapped in candy coated refreshing pop. The sonic flecks add a shimmering magical quality while the zesty guitars provide enough sting to keep it breezy and invigorating. This sun kissed sweet little ditty will put a smile on your face and brighten any cloudy day.
